    When I select Start - Explorer, it opens with the C: folder expanded to show
    all subfolders plus the Users folder is further expanded to the following
    levels:
    Users
    Owner
    AppData
    Roaming
    Microsoft
    Windows
    Start Menu
    Programs

    How do I stop this so it just shows me the first level of subfolders in C:?

    Bob
     
  2. Max

    Max Guest

    Change shortcut to:
    %windir%\explorer.exe ,/e,c:\
